Located in the rural area of Butler County, Pennsylvania, Cranberry Township is home to a number of religious congregations. From the traditional to the contemporary, from the Protestant and Catholic Christian faiths to other denominations, there is no shortage of places for people to connect with faith-based activities in Cranberry Township. Whether you are looking for a strong children’s program or just need a place to find solace during difficult times, these churches are here to support their community. The churches offer worship services that range from contemporary praise and worship styles to more traditional liturgies. They also provide opportunities for fellowship and outreach through various ministries including youth programs, mission trips, local service projects and more. No matter what your spiritual needs may be, there is a church in Cranberry Township that can help you find peace and guidance in your life.
